Costs, speed, and safety

Pricing with MoneyGram depends on three main factors: where you’re sending from, where you’re sending to, and how the money is funded and received. Card‑funded transfers tend to be faster but can cost more in fees than bank‑funded transfers. Exchange rates also include a markup over the mid‑market rate, which is common across traditional remittance providers.

Transfer speed and limits

Cash pickup is often ready in minutes once paid and approved, while bank deposits can take from minutes to one business day depending on the corridor and banking hours. Sending limits vary by country, verification status, and payment method. Verified users usually receive higher limits and a smoother checkout experience.

If you’re sending a large amount, plan ahead and complete any required identity checks early. MoneyGram may request additional documentation to comply with anti‑money laundering rules, which can temporarily delay a transfer but ultimately protects users and the network.

Security and compliance

MoneyGram operates under stringent financial regulations in multiple jurisdictions. The company uses encryption, fraud monitoring, and secure authentication to keep accounts safer. You can add extra protection with biometric login on the app and by sharing the reference number only with your intended recipient. If something looks off, customer support and the in‑app help center provide guidance on cancelations and disputes for eligible transfers.

Scams often target fast cash services. MoneyGram regularly publishes warnings and tips. Never send money to someone you don’t know or to claim a prize, and double‑check recipient details before you hit send.

Cash pickup is often available within minutes after payment and approval. Bank deposits can take from minutes to one business day, depending on destination banks, currency, and local cut‑off times. You’ll see an estimated delivery time before you confirm.

Fees vary by corridor, funding, and payout method. Card funding is usually faster but can cost more. Exchange rates include a markup over the mid‑market rate. The quote screen shows the exact fee, rate, and what your recipient will receive before you send.

Common options include bank account, debit card, and credit card, while cash is accepted at agent locations. Availability depends on your country. Note that some card issuers treat transfers as cash advances and may charge additional fees or interest.

MoneyGram uses encryption, account monitoring, and identity checks to protect users. Enable biometric login, keep your reference number private, and only send to people you know. If you suspect fraud, contact support immediately to review cancellation options.

You’ll typically need a government ID and basic personal details. Verification can raise your sending limits. For larger amounts, additional documents may be required to meet regulatory rules. Complete checks early to avoid delays on time‑sensitive transfers.
